Negligence, among the trademark symptoms of ADHD, is defined by troubles in preserving focus and completing jobs effectively. For adults, this often manifests as chronic lack of organization, regular lapse of memory, and a tendency to start multiple projects without finishing them. This symptom can interfere with work performance, relationships, and everyday obligations.
Hyperactivity/Impulsivity
While hyperactivity may decrease with age, numerous adults with [ADHD Signs](http://122.51.46.213/attention-disorder-symptoms-in-adults1194) still experience restlessness. This can lead to impulsive choices, which may affect individual and professional relationships. Adults might discover themselves interrupting discussions, acting without considering the effects, or feeling a desire to always be on the go.
Psychological Dysregulation
Adults with ADHD frequently report increased psychological sensitivity. They may experience intense feelings that can be challenging to manage. Mood swings can lead to conflicts in relationships and difficulties in professional settings. This symptom can frequently be overlooked, but it plays a significant function in the overall experience of ADHD.
Executive Dysfunction
Executive functions are cognitive procedures that aid with planning, organizing, and carrying out tasks. Adults with ADHD might deal with establishing concerns, managing time efficiently, and keeping an eye on multiple obligations. This dysfunction can cause chronic procrastination and missed due dates.

Structured Routines: Establishing an everyday regimen can assist develop predictability and focus. Utilizing planners or digital calendars can help in maintaining schedules.

Prioritization: Break tasks into smaller sized, workable pieces, and prioritize them to prevent sensation overwhelmed.

Mindfulness and Meditation: Techniques that promote mindfulness can help in reducing tension and improve psychological guideline.

Exercise: Regular exercise can mitigate some ADHD symptoms, such as uneasyness and state of mind swings.

Professional Help: Therapy, especially c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), can provide coping techniques and psychological assistance. Medication might likewise be an alternative for some adults.

Support Groups: Connecting with others who experience comparable challenges can provide understanding and support.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: Can adults develop ADHD later in life?
ADHD typically comes from youth and lasts into adulthood. However, symptoms might end up being more apparent or troublesome throughout the adult years due to increased obligations.
Q2: How is ADHD identified in adults?
Identifying ADHD in adults includes an extensive evaluation by a healthcare professional, consisting of clinical interviews, questionnaires, and consideration of case history.
Q3: Is ADHD connected to other mental health conditions?
Yes, ADHD often exists side-by-side with other conditions such as anxiety disorders, anxiety, and discovering specials needs.
Q4: How can I advocate for myself at work if I have ADHD?
Consider discussing your obstacles with a trusted supervisor or human resources. Request affordable lodgings that can help you handle your workload more effectively.
Q5: Are there specific treatments for adult ADHD?
Treatment usually consists of a mix of medication, therapy, training, and lifestyle modifications customized to the person's requirements.
